Abstract

The RSUD Ciamis website functions as a digital platform to deliver announcements, health services, and other health-related information to the public and patients. As an official information medium, this website plays an important role in maintaining communication between the hospital, patients, patients’ families, and other stakeholders. However, the current user interface design is considered less optimal in terms of usability, aesthetics, and emotional perspective. Such limitations may reduce user comfort, trust, and satisfaction. Therefore, a redesign of the interface is required, not only focusing on functionality but also considering users’ emotional perspectives and strengthening the brand identity of RSUD Ciamis. This study employed the Kansei Engineering method, which translates emotional impressions into concrete design elements. A total of 50 respondents were involved in evaluating five web interface specimens from Indonesian hospitals using ten selected Kansei words, namely firm, warm, simple, clear, modern, professional, calm, dynamic, clean, and safe. The research procedure consisted of several stages: investigation (selection of Kansei words, translation into semantic differential scales, determination of specimens, classification of design elements, and respondent selection), evaluation (data collection through questionnaires and statistical analysis), and recommendation (PLS analysis and design proposals). The study produced a user interface design for the RSUD Ciamis website that is expected to enhance visual appeal, clarity of information, and ease of navigation. Nevertheless, its effectiveness cannot be assured without post-implementation evaluation. Therefore, further research is recommended to conduct usability testing and explore additional Kansei words to enrich design insights and ensure continuous improvement.
